Getting in flight (Golder & Tellis 1997)
● New durables have a rapid takeoff in early sales (aka “takeoff”)
● Price & Market Penetration are the determinant factors
○ Other factors such as category specific and
● Common factors ○ At takeoff Price is 63% of introduction ○ Time to takeoff is 6 years (down from 18
years pre-WWII) ○ Market penetration at takeoff is 1.7%
● Implications ○ Heavy impact of price reduction ○ 7 years in, if takeoff isn’t happening - pause
and refactor

More Golder & Tellis
● Looked at additional categories ○ (CD Player, Color TV, Computer, Dishwasher, Dryer, Freezers,
● Microwave, Refrigerator, VCR, Washing Machine) ● Mean time to takeoff varies across product categories
○ Eight years for white goods (kitchen and laundry appliances) ○ Two years for brown goods (entertainment and information
products)
● Mean time to takeoff varies across countries ○ Four years for Scandinavian countries ○ Seven years for Mediterranean countries ○ Differences more due to cultural rather than economic factors
● The probability of takeoff of a new product in a target country increases with prior takeoffs in other countries

Dipping your toes into the market
First to Market
● Data from 500 brands in 50 consumer product categories ○ Mean market share of pioneers is 10%, much lower than the 30%
previously reported
● Half this difference comes from sampling both survivors and non-survivors
○ The rest is due to identification of pioneers using historical data ○ 47% of market pioneers fail ○ 11% of pioneers are current market share leaders ○ Results not sensitive to the age of the categories.
● Pioneers tend to be share leaders for about 10-15 years. ○ Rewards to pioneering are greater in nondurable goods
● Early market leaders (usually enter market after pioneer) ○ Have a higher share (3x of pioneer) ○ Enjoy a higher success rate than pioneers ○ End up as market leaders more frequently than pioneers
● In tech Results are consistent ○ 13% of pioneers are current market leaders
■ Mean market share of pioneers is 9%
Source: Prof. Puneet Manchanda
The real advantage
● Being a pioneer is neither a necessary nor a sufficient condition for long term success and leadership
● Entering after the pioneer seems to carry bigger rewards
● Early leaders (as opposed to pioneers) seem to succeed because they have
○ A vision of the mass market ○ Managerial persistence ○ Financial commitment ○ Continuous and relentless innovation ○ Asset leverage (for category extensions)

Degrees of price discrimination
First degree First-degree price discrimination, alternatively known as perfect price discrimination, occurs when a firm charges a different price for every unit consumed.
The firm is able to charge the maximum possible price for each unit which enables the firm to capture all available consumer surplus for itself. In practice, first-degree discrimination is rare.
Second degree Second-degree price discrimination means charging a different price for different quantities, such as quantity discounts for bulk purchases.
Third degree Third-degree price discrimination means charging a different price to different consumer groups. For example, rail and tube travellers can be subdivided into commuter and casual travellers, and cinema goers can be subdivide into adults and children. Splitting the market into peak and off peak use is very common and occurs with gas, electricity, and telephone supply, as well as gym membership and parking charges. Third-degree discrimination is the commonest type.
